Permian Basin Royalty Trust
ENERGY · OIL & GAS MIDSTREAM · USA
The Permian Basin Royalty Trust, an express trust, holds primary royalty interests in various oil and gas properties in the United States. The company is headquartered in Dallas, Texas.

ENERGY · OIL & GAS MIDSTREAM · USA
TC Energy Corporation is an energy infrastructure company in North America. The company is headquartered in Calgary, Canada.
